Construction and Teaching Practice of Multi-Dimensional Information Laboratory Resources of Inorganic Chemistry

Abstract:

In view of the obvious differences in chemistry basis, the ability of theoretical and laboratory connection, and the level of laboratory skills among the freshmen with chemical-based majors, the teaching team of inorganic chemistry of Tianjin University has constructed multi-dimensional information laboratory resources of inorganic chemistry including classroom demonstration experiment, online opening of laboratory course, experimental safety management and education, and the production and application of virtual simulation experiment. Those resources have been applied to the teaching practice of inorganic chemistry, which could solve the difficulties of students in the learning process and improve the teaching effect and efficiency.
